Chapter 58 The tension on the dock was palpable as Ethan Price stood before us, flanked by a group of armed guards. His smirk carried the confidence of a man who thought he’d already won. “Well, well,” Ethan drawled, stepping closer. “I have to admit, you’re resourceful. Redmond underestimated you, but unfortunately for you, I don’t make the same mistakes.” Alex stood his ground, his expression cool and defiant. “And yet, here you are, gloating instead of stopping us. What’s the matter, Ethan? Feeling insecure about your position?” Ethan’s smirk faltered for a fraction of a second, but he quickly recovered. “You think you’re clever, don’t you? But this ends now.” His guards raised their weapons, and I felt Alex’s hand brush mine—a silent signal. My pulse quickened, but I nodded subtly
